The Florida Historic Capitol, standing since 1845, has been restored to its 1902 appearance and now serves as a museum at the heart of the state’s Capitol complex. Under its iconic stained-glass dome, visitors explore Florida’s political history through exhibits, photographs, recordings, and interactive displays. Restored spaces include the original Governor’s office and legislative chambers. With over 250 artifacts across 21 rooms, the museum traces the evolution of Florida’s government from its territorial beginnings to today.
